"This was my first, but won't be my last time to Tandoor Char House. The restaurant is in an assuming, non-descript storefront, so it can be easily overlooked - make a special trip. I had lunch with a friend.
My chicken kabob wrap was packed full of nicely spiced chicken, lettuce and tomatoes (have them put the salad in the wrap), and it came with a plate full of their chaat fries (spicy, curly fries). All meals include a variety of chutney's - the Achar is fresh, crisp and SPICY (not for the faint of hear), the Tamarind is sweet without being sugary, and Cilantro is fresh an aromatic. My friend's Baigan Masala was rich, flavorful and the eggplant wasn't overcooked - cooked yet still firm (al dente).
I'll be back....."

"Very engaged service, an owner who cares and delicious Indian and Pakistani specialties including both curried and tandoori dishes. Excellent eggplant and beef in curried stews simmered until full of complex flavors. Tandoori Lamb was charred and tender. Samosas make a nice starter and the mango lassi is superb with more mango than some mango juice. Good recommendations on the menu. Pretty quiet at lunch. Hope dinner is more active so this good place stays around."
